Katsina police eliminate kidnap kingpin after shootout

    0

    Officers of the Katsina State Police Command have eliminated a popular bandit leader identified as Hamisu Mopol, during a shootout near the permanent site of Federal University Dutsin-Ma (FUDMA), Katsina.

    Security expert Bakatsine revealed via a post on his X social media handle that the operation was conducted on Monday, May 5 by officers from the Dutsin-Ma Police Division.

    Bakatsine stated that the confrontation happened during a routine patrol, when the officers encountered Mopol’s gang on the outskirts of the town.

    Hamisu Mopol, the son of Hajiya Lamiso, a woman often accused by locals of sheltering bandits was fatally shot during the exchange.

    The post read, “Yesterday afternoon, Dutsin-Ma Police clashed with bandits near FUDMA permanent site.

    “Bandits leader Hamisu Mopol was killed.

    “He’s the son of Hajiya Lamiso, often accused of sheltering bandits; witnesses say their bikes were frequently seen at her home.”

    However, the state’s police spokesperson Assistant Superintendent (ASP) Abubakar Sadiq-Aliyu has not yet commented on the issue.
